Output 0cd8a7ff6099bfa76917a14dfd1c1bfde891efe4e0bffe6f4a94bc3df158a363:5

value
16452645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a32117611461c42d14862a7177c3f6659ff64b2 OP_EQUAL
address
3EHj9pJgfN5AFRqFjdaCUMHFSp2T1uiVV3
transaction
0cd8a7ff6099bfa76917a14dfd1c1bfde891efe4e0bffe6f4a94bc3df158a363
confirmations
380389
spent
true